annotate README.txt @ 224:9d0a19b4518b
o extract_python fixes:
- now returns None for non-string arguments
- no longer extracts strings from nested function calls
refs #38
- use the correct starting line number in multi-line gettext function
calls
- avoids falsely identifying string keyword arg defaults from
function definition names that match a keyword, e.g.:
def gettext(foo='bar')
- avoid capturing translator comments embedded within a gettext
function call
- default the file encoding to iso-8859-1 instead of ascii when
missing a magic encoding comment, to emulate pre Python 2.5
behavior. Python warns about 'non-ascii' chars when there is no magic
encoding comment, but < 2.5 actually treats them as iso-8859-1 for
backwards compat (PEP 263). >= 2.5 treats them as strict ascii
o extract fixes:
- filter out messages that don't contain strings where the keyword
specification calls for
fixes #39
- filter out empty string messages and emit a warning about them,
like xgettext
author |
pjenvey |
date |
Wed, 18 Jul 2007 00:29:04 +0000 |
parents |
e9eaddab598e |
children |
|
rev |
line source |
3
|
1 About Babel
|
|
2 ===========
|
|
3
|
|
4 Babel is a Python library that provides an integrated collection of
|
|
5 utilities that assist with internationalizing and localizing Python
|
|
6 applications (in particular web-based applications.)
|
|
7
|
|
8 Details can be found in the HTML files in the `doc` folder.
|
|
9
|
|
10 For more information please visit the Babel web site:
|
|
11
|
|
12 <http://babel.edgewall.org/>
|